One-Pot Synthesis of Polyfunctionalized 4H-Chromenes and Dihydrocoumarins Based on Copper(II) Bromide-Catalyzed CC Coupling of Benzylic Alcohols with Ketene Dithioacetals

The synthesis of polyfunctionalized 4H‐chromenes 3 and dihydrocoumarins 4 has been developed from the same substrates. Catalyzed by copper(II) bromide (0.3 equiv.), the reactions of the easily available ketene dithioacetals 1 with 2‐(hydroxymethyl)phenols 2 lead to 4H‐chromenes 3 in high to excellent yields in dichloromethane solvent, whereas, 3,4‐trans‐disubstituted dihydrocoumarins 4 are obtained
